Two small changes here:
Prepends
@to the chunk name of bundled files so that the shortsrc name becomesbundle:fileinstead of[string "bundle:file"]in error messages. This is mostly just a convenience thing because the[string ""]just clutters the output on error.Luvi now uses
luaL_tracebackinstead of callingdebug.traceback. We have lua53-compat which backfills this function for PUC 5.1 and it's available by default from every other Lua we support.
